Amsterdam, the city of canals and tulips, is located in the Netherlands, a country in Northwestern Europe. Situated in the province of North Holland, Amsterdam is the capital and largest city of the Netherlands. It is known for its picturesque beauty, rich cultural heritage, and vibrant atmosphere.

Nestled in the western part of the Netherlands, Amsterdam lies approximately 2 meters below sea level, making it an intriguing destination with its unique landscape and intricate network of canals. The city is built around a series of concentric semi-circular canals, which are now recognized as a UNESCO World Heritage site.

The location of Amsterdam within the Netherlands makes it easily accessible for travelers. Schiphol Airport, one of Europe’s busiest airports, serves as a major international hub, connecting Amsterdam to destinations worldwide. Additionally, the city boasts an efficient public transportation system, including trams, buses, and trains, allowing visitors to navigate the city with ease.

One of the first things that will amaze you about Amsterdam is its picturesque canal system. With more than 100 kilometers of canals and over 1,500 bridges, the city’s waterways are like a work of art.
